The photochemical-reaction yields after IR multiphoton excitation of CHFCl-CF2Cl are reported and evaluated in terms of the steady-state rate coefficient for reactant decay k(st) = 106.1+/-0.3(I/MWcm-2)s-1).The dominant primary reaction channels are α,β HCl and HF elimination, although minor pathways seem to include Cl2 elimination and other channels, which are discussed.The major uncertainty in the comparison with theoretical estimates resides in the fraction of C-F chromophore band strength with contributes to excitation.The total band strength for the range from 940 cm-1 to 1310 cm-1 is reported to be G = <*> = 8.2 pm2.
